## v2.8.0 — Changed defaults

The Gaugewell metrics-aggregation sidecar now flushes every 15 seconds instead of 60, and histogram buckets default to the coarse preset. Customers upgrading from 2.7.x will see higher write volume unless they pin the old values. No action is needed for managed tenants; Opsline handles those centrally. For self-hosted support tickets, compare the customer's file against the new shipped defaults below.

service settings:
PRAIX_LOG_LEVEL=error
PRAIX_METRICS_HOST=metrics.praix.qorvelcorp.corp
PRAIX_POOL_SIZE=16

Subject: Night-Shift Access — Welcome Aboard

Hello, and welcome to Orvane Labs. As a new starter on the overnight support rotation, please enter through the south vestibule after 22:00, as the main doors are alarmed overnight. Sign in at the wall ledger each shift. To release the vestibule door, carefully enter the code below.

turnstile pass: bdg-FVNQRS-72965873

Subject: Pricing decision — Veltro line

Team,

After the margin review, we are raising Veltro Standard by four percent and holding Veltro Pro flat to protect share against Quorast's discounting. Channel partners will be notified at month-end; no grandfathering beyond existing contracts. Department heads should update their revenue models accordingly before the forecast cycle. For context, the following note is restricted to this distribution.

board note of bawep-tajef: Queniusek Systems plans to raise the Quenvan list price by 53.1 percent in March. The pricing group signed off on a budget of $176.4 million for Project Drueth. The renewal with Casionix Partners closes at $142.5 million a year, 8.3 percent below the last contract. Project Fraax slips by six weeks because of the tooling delay.

### Notes — VaultSpin sync, Tuesday

Quick recap for whoever inherits this: VaultSpin now rotates service credentials every 72 hours instead of weekly. The retry loop got a jitter fix so we stop hammering the broker at the top of the hour. Dry-run mode is still the default in staging — don't flip it without checking the runbook. If rotation stalls or you see stale tokens, ping the owner listed below.

account owner for fajep-yagef: Kasix Eliiel